In the event that nothing of these disability-centric adult dating sites connect the attract, following imagine deciding on even more conventional choice such as OKCupid, eHarmony, Tinder or Meets. You may also deal with a little more questioning or even located highest getting rejected pricing, but these services enjoys notably large member bases on precisely how to select from.

Our advice for tackling these types of mainstream dating sites is simple: make your profile to help you echo your authentic care about, plus don’t be afraid to transmit messages to people you might be interested in. Regarding the texts, move forward from merely stating hello, and begin an authentic conversationment towards the similarities between the two away from your, or express an enjoyable otherwise funny sense and you will connect it to the character.

Yet not, remember why these websites are much bigger than niche disability online dating sites and lots of profiles, particularly feminine, may overwhelmed from the dozens of messages. Therefore don’t be concerned if you don’t hear straight back out of somebody inside the initial few weeks; it’s entirely possible they just have not seen the term yet ,.

Dr. Sheypuk focuses on dating, relationship and you may sexuality among disabled, many some body only consider their particular since the a handicap sexpert. People manage discover Dr. Sheypuk regarding winning this new Ms. Wheelchair Ny pageant inside 2012, as the basic design so you can walk off a runway during the New york Styles Few days, her preferred TedX chat from the Barnard College, her profitable private practice into the Manhattan, or their current interview to your PBS, where she dives on the stigmas encompassing handicapped dating.

I recently requested their unique concerning the stereotypes people who have handicaps deal with every day, and you may just what she thinks we should do in order to change it. Listed here are their own viewpoint:

Mass media doesn’t generally speaking show people who have kiireellinen linkki disabilities while the romantically readily available

DS: The biggest stigmas try that we have been still seen as asexual and you may not stunning. Our anatomical bodies are very different than what some body look for toward a daily basis, [so] its unknown territory in their mind. Throughout the media, our company is never ever illustrated because sexual individuals. We are never for the one thing sexual otherwise glamorous otherwise beautiful. Ergo, people don’t as a whole build one to association.

Able-bodied somebody hardly understand what its like to date individuals having an impairment and therefore both cure it

DS: When you’re looking to enter the dating business, [for] those who you touch, it would be the first occasion they usually have actually ever spoken with someone in an excellent wheelchair. Your [encounter] a few of these obstacles and you may obstacles right from the start [because] people do not know any thing on which it is desire to has a great disability, and it is difficult to get more. After they manage see regions of your handicap, they will not know the way … who would work in a romance. [They might inquire]: Make use of a beneficial motorized wheelchair day long? Therefore chances are they easily think, How would we become around? How would we wade cities to each other? How does she step out of brand new wheelchair? It’s just a total decreased coverage. That is why I really do plenty news really works [and] try to introduce [the issue to help you] some body as much as i is also.
